NEC Launches Ultra-slim LaVie X Ultrabook In Japan


NEC today announced the release of the LaVie X, a 15.6-inch notebook that is just 12.8mm thick and weighs just 1.59kg.

The Windows 8 notebook has a 15.6-inch full HD IPS panel and a 1920 x 1080 resolution. Under the hood is an Intel Core i7-3517U processor clocked at 1.9GHz, a a 4GB RAM (support PC3-12800, dual-channel) and a 256GB SATA 3.0 SSD. Other features include a 2-megapixel web-camera, two USB 3.0 ports, WiFi 802.11 b/g/n, Bluetooth 4.0, an SDXC slot, and HDMI support. It's battery can be fully charged in less that 1 hour and is able to power the device for about 7 hours, according to NEC.



The LaVie X will be available this coming December 27th in the Japanese market.
